Emerson, Lake & Palmer general.

I just listened to Tarkus for the first time today after holding on to that LP for a couple of years now. The titular suite isn't too bad, but I can empathize with some fans pointing to the B side as its weakest link.

Now re-listening to Brain Salad Surgery and while "Karn Evil 9", or anything on that album, is no match for "Tarkus" (Side A) in my opinion, I feel the album is more well-rounded than Tarkus. It's quieter for one thing, the mixing and overall production is better, whereas in Tarkus I felt Emerson's keys were way too overpowering, or they just sound like that through my Polk T15s.
